Author
Alan Moorehead
Alan McCrae Moorehead OBE (22 July 1910 — 29 September 1983) was a war correspondent and author of popular histories, most notably two books on the nineteenth-century exploration of the Nile, The White Nile (1960) and The Blue Nile (1962). Australian-born, he lived in England, and Italy, from 1937....
